However, it s important to ensure the sensor is the actual cause of symptoms (e.g., rough idle, overheating, or CEL codes like P0115, P0116, or P0117) before replacing it.
### **Recommendation**
1. **Verify the Symptom** Confirm the sensor is the issue by checking for CEL codes (use an OBD-I scanner) or testing the sensor s resistance with a multimeter (should be 1,700 3,500 ohms at room temperature, dropping as it heats up).
2. **Buy from a Reputable Source** Purchase from **RockAuto, Amazon (with verified seller reviews), or a local auto parts store** to avoid counterfeit parts. Look for brands like **ACDelco, Bosch, or Motorcraft** if going aftermarket.
3. **Consider a Multimeter Test** If unsure, test the old sensor before buying a new one to confirm failure.
4. **Inspect Related Components** While replacing the sensor, check the **thermostat, water pump, and hoses** for wear, as these often fail around the same time.
5. **Install Properly** Use **anti-seize compound** on the threads to prevent seizing, and ensure the sensor is tightened to the manufacturer s spec (usually 20 25 ft-lbs).
6. **Reset the CEL** After installation, clear the check engine light with a scan tool or by disconnecting the battery for 5 10 minutes.
